#4c7010 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c7010 is composed of 29.8% red, 43.9%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.7%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 82.5 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 25.1%. #4c7010 color hex could be obtained by blending #98e020 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#4c7010
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060901 is the darkest color, while #fbfef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c7010
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#41443c is the less saturated color, while #507f01 is the most saturated one.
